Output cf58e962198d2eb787e807b26306e57315e663bb818246f353289b6ec3733e76:0

value
2668312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8b1b2e82b36b7e74a76a37b72b0c189ba18a949 OP_EQUAL
address
3NuPZnGc3JDYNf6jg52eysmhwvjUxi7czo
transaction
cf58e962198d2eb787e807b26306e57315e663bb818246f353289b6ec3733e76